The NIMS - Nehru Institute of Management Studies accepts TANCET results for admission to its PGDM programme. According to the NIMS - Nehru Institute of Management Studies cutoffs for 2024, the TANCET cutoff percentile for applicants in the General All India category was less than 90. According to the cutoff pattern from previous years, an applicant can therefore be admitted to Nehru College of Management with a 90 percentile.

Putting in an application for MBA and MCA at Sri Venkateswara College of Computer Applications and Management means having to clear the TANCET. Selection of candidates is done by strictly sticking to the TANCET merit lists. Those without a valid TANCET score will not be able to apply for these postgraduate programs. Because of the entrance exam, candidates are all evaluated in the same way.
